
Overview
Lauren Zeitlinger, DO, is an orthopaedic surgeon with UPMC Orthopaedic Care. She received her medical degree from Lincoln Memorial University-DeBusk College of Osteopathic Medicine and completed her orthopaedic residency at The Orthopedic Residency of York, WellSpan York Hospital, followed by her Sarcoma and Advanced Clinical Fellowship – Musculoskeletal Oncology at the University of California – Davis. Dr. Zeitlinger’s clinical interests include complex joint reconstruction, complex limb salvage, reconstruction and/or fixation of metastatic bone disease, pediatric benign bone and soft tissue tumors, pediatric malignant bone and soft tissue tumors.
Her top areas of expertise are Adult Soft Tissue Sarcoma, Baker Cyst, Bone Tumor, and Synovial Osteochondromatosis.
Her clinical research consists of co-authoring 13 peer reviewed articles. MediFind looks at clinical research from the past 15 years.
